Django中的两个表用户和auth_user是用于什么的?

时间:2014-03-24 21:27:17

标签: django django-forms django-admin django-database

我知道User modelDjango的功能。但是当我syncdb时,我看到创建了许多auth_* tables,有一个auth_user。还有另一个User表。 列中的它们之间存在差异。我在这里附上他们。当我添加新用户时,它会存储在auth_user表中,但User表为空。那么这个User表是什么(为什么它是空的时候创建的)以及它有用的地方。为什么没有人口?

enter image description here enter image description here

1 个答案:

答案 0 :(得分:1)

auth_user表跟踪Django包含的身份验证系统的注册用户。

Django不会创建Users表。它必须由您正在使用的第三方Django应用程序创建,或者完全通过其他过程创建。